Method and cast components for cold formed center sill rail car modification programs and railcars formed thereby

A method of modification of a railcar which includes providing an existing railcar with a cold formed center sill; removing an upper portion of the railcar; Cutting and splicing the center sill; Forming an upper railcar body having top chord sections and a pair of end walls and side walls coupled to the top chord structure, wherein each sidewall includes a side sheet, a plurality of side stakes and side sill; Forming an underframe construction including the spliced center sill, bolsters configured to be above truck assemblies and coupled to the center sill and a plurality of lateral I-Beam cross bearers that extend from the center sill toward and stopping short of the inside of the side sheet, and wherein the cross bearers include vertical connection plates configures for coupling to side stakes which are positioned between the bolsters; and Coupling the upper body to the underframe.

CAST COMPONENTS FOR COLD FORMED CENTER SILL RAIL CAR MODIFICATION PROGRAMS

A casting or casting components for a modification of a railcar includes at least one of i) a splice casting for a roll formed railcar center sill having a center section with the same profile as the exterior of the rolled formed railcar center sill with two end sections that telescope into the interior of spliced center sill sections, wherein the splice casting as a total weight is less than 100 LBS, and ii) a cast transition casting configured for positioning between a cold formed center sill and a draft arm of a railcar wherein the cast transition casting is less than 75 LBS.

Assembly-type car body and rail vehicle

An assembly-type car body and a rail vehicle. A roof, an underframe, side roofs and side walls of the assembly-type car body are separately formed by assembling double-layer pultruded profiles, and each double-layer pultruded profile comprises an outer plate, an inner plate and cavities formed by separating an interlayer between the outer plate and the inner plate using ribs; the upper edge and the lower edge of each side roof are respectively connected to an edge of the roof and the upper edge of a side wall by means of lapping joints, and the lower edge of each side wall is connected to an edge of the underframe by means of a side wall connector; each side wall connector is a double-layer pultruded profile unit, the upper edge of the side wall connector is connected to the lower edge of the side wall by a plug joint.
